Transaction 143d584088f29e8f9536eb6b5bcba79d020e4a40e909362c39645c71be78097b

1 Input
2 Outputs
  • 143d584088f29e8f9536eb6b5bcba79d020e4a40e909362c39645c71be78097b:0
  • value  17948964
    address  1NYqxV4LP3PurLNt3A63rGP7QyRjw2WsHd
  • 143d584088f29e8f9536eb6b5bcba79d020e4a40e909362c39645c71be78097b:1
  • value  2980000
    address  161SrY5VWDHttSAQWnNfuw9AaMZ8ixCwCg